Weather & Roofing Conditions in Sun City Center
Sun City Center in Florida experiences a subtropical climate that significantly impacts roofing needs for its residences. The area is known for its hot, humid summers and mild winters, which subject roofs to UV degradation and thermal stress. Frequent heavy rains and the potential for hurricanes contribute to storm damage risks, necessitating durable and well-maintained roofing systems to protect homes. The high UV exposure can cause materials like asphalt shingles to deteriorate more quickly than in less intense climates, leading to fading, brittleness, and loss of granules. Furthermore, conditions such as hail and strong wind events can physically damage roofing materials, leading to immediate repair needs to prevent water intrusion. Given these conditions, it’s crucial for homeowners in Sun City Center to consider roofing solutions that are resistant to UV light, capable of withstanding high winds, and efficient at repelling heavy rain. Local building codes and HOA regulations also dictate specific requirements to ensure that roofs are capable of handling the unique weather challenges of this Floridian community.

Types of Homes & Roofs in Sun City Center
In Sun City Center, Florida, a range of residential and commercial buildings contribute to the area’s architectural landscape. This vibrant community primarily features single-family homes, villas, and apartment complexes that cater to a diverse demographic, including retirees and families. These homes often showcase roofing systems designed for subtropical climates, such as tile roofs, which offer durability and resistance against Florida’s frequent storms and intense sunshine. Additionally, metal roofing is a popular choice for its longevity and energy efficiency, reflecting heat away from the structure. Commercial buildings in Sun City Center typically adopt flat or low-slope roofs, incorporating materials like built-up roofing (BUR), modified bitumen, and single-ply membranes, which are favored for their low maintenance and strong performance against the elements. FAQs
1. How much does it cost to replace a roof in Sun City Center, FL?
The average roof replacement cost is around $25,000, but can range from $7,500 to over $50,000 depending on your roof’s size, materials, and complexity.
2. How long does a typical roof last in Florida?
In Florida’s climate, asphalt shingle roofs last 15–20 years, while tile and metal roofs can last 30–50 years with proper maintenance.
3. Do I need a permit to replace my roof in Sun City Center?
Yes, a roofing permit is required in Sun City Center. Your licensed roofing contractor will typically handle this process for you.
4. What roofing materials work best in Florida’s climate?
Metal, tile, and high-quality asphalt shingles are most durable against Florida’s heat, humidity, and hurricanes.
5. Will my homeowners insurance cover a roof replacement?
It depends on your policy and the cause of damage. Storm-related damage is often covered, but wear and tear usually isn’t.
